State legislations stipulate just how bail bondsmen can obtain brand-new company. As an instance, they're not permitted to use bail services from jail.


By Lainie Petersen Updated October 26, 2018 Bail bond business help individuals who have been billed with criminal offenses live outside of prison legally while waiting for trial. State legislations control bail bond firms, and the guidelines can be rather complicated. Business owners who may consider entering into this company ought to understand that there is a solid trend amongst lobbyist and lawful teams to support the elimination or decrease of cash money bail needs in the court system, which might make bail bond companies out-of-date.


Sometimes, the charged might be launched on his/her very own recognizance, which implies that the court counts on the specific to appear for the next court date and to adhere to all conditions set by the court, such as holding a work or abstaining from using alcohol.

If the charged has actually satisfied the conditions of the bail, the money will be returned - https://www.wantedly.com/id/bailbondsinc. In lots of instances, the implicated can not pay for to pay the full bail amount.


The bail bond company offers the implicated a surety bond, which works as insurance coverage that the charged will reveal up in court when ordered to do so. Individuals that have a bail bond firm are often called bail bondsmen. The expense of the prison bond is normally a percent of the bail.

Furthermore, the bail bond firm may call for the accused to protect the bond with security, such as the deed to a residence, or an auto, fashion jewelry or various other belongings. A pal or family member of the charged may consent to put up collateral to protect the bond. From there, the bail bond firm sends out an agent to the court to pay a part of the bond and guarantee repayment of the remainder need to the accused not show up when called for to do so.

The percent paid by the client is not returned to him yet is accumulated as the cost for the bond itself. This is why some lawful advisors recommend that customers try to prevent utilizing a bond solution whenever feasible. Attorneys will sometimes attempt to deal with courts to decrease the amount of bond to ensure that the charged and his household are not needed to pay what can be a huge amount of money that they will never return.


Some clients stop working to do so. When this happens, bail bond company owners are empowered by law to nab their customers and bring them to court. Clients are often obtained by specialist bail enforcement agents, in some cases referred to as bounty This Site hunters, who are educated in locating and securely nailing fugitives.

This might compel the firm to confiscate any type of assets utilized as security for the bond. This consists of security provided by 3rd parties, such as buddies and household participants. The procedure of ending up being a bondsman is different for every single state, but typically needs an individual to complete an accepted training program, go through a background check and acquire a surety bond.


It needs to be noted that states control both refine web servers and private investigators, so individuals supplying either or both services may need to acquire a different professional license for every profession. Bail bond solution proprietors ought to investigate the legislation in their states to discover what kind of licensing demands they'll have to satisfy.

Individuals entering this market needs to be aware of the possible dangers included. Tavares. These consist of: Functioning within the criminal justice system: While not every person looking for a bail bond is guilty of a crime, many customers are, or have remained in the past. It can be challenging to function with this populace, especially since several may be living with psychological illness or a medication dependency


If the charged becomes a fugitive, the bail bond firm will need to take those properties, which may be a home, a cars and truck or various other beneficial property. In some severe situations, the individual who set up the security, in addition to their relative, may end up being homeless because of home repossession.


Employing recovery agents (bounty hunters): Recovery agents have considerable powers when trying to locate a fugitive. These powers consist of operating in numerous states and being able to make use of force when capturing a fugitive. Due to this degree of authority and obligation, bail bond company proprietors require to be cautious when working with recovery representatives and set clear specifications regarding their conduct while looking for a client.
